How to Create a Filter in Survey and Data Settings
Creating a filter in Survey and Data Settings allows you to target specific groups of people for your surveys or phone lists. This can be useful for targeting specific demographics or voter histories. Follow the steps below to create a filter.
Step 1: Access Survey and Data Settings
To begin, click on the settings icon in the top right corner of your screen. Then, select "Survey and Data Settings" from the dropdown menu.
Step 2: Navigate to Set Filters
Once on the Survey and Data Settings page, click on the "Set Filters" button. This will take you to the page where you can create your filter.
Step 3: Choose Filter Type
At the top of the Set Filters page, you will see two options for filter types: doors (represented by a man walking icon) and phones (represented by a phone icon). Toggle the switch to the appropriate option for your filter.
Step 4: Name Your Filter
Next, click on the name box and type in a name for your filter. This will help you easily identify and select your filter in the future.
Step 5: Select Target Criteria
Now it's time to choose the criteria for your filter. You can filter by party affiliation, voter frequency, registration date, age, gender, tags, and last contacted. Simply click on the dropdown menus and select your desired criteria.
Note: The process for setting up a pre-set filter is the same as setting up a walk list or phone list.
Step 6: Use the Tag Dropdown
The most popular section to use in creating a filter is the Tag dropdown. Here, you can select election history tags, uploaded tags, or survey tags to further refine your filter.
Note: If you are setting up a filter that involves both an election history tag (e.g. 2020 General Voters) and an uploaded tag (e.g. calculated party hard republican), make sure to toggle on the "General tags And/Or" filter. This will make the statement an "And" function, meaning the voter must meet both criteria (in this example, they must have voted in the 2020 General election and be a Hard Republican).
Step 7: Select Misc Filter for Phone Filters
If you are creating a phone filter, the last dropdown you will need to select is the Misc filter. Here, you can choose to call home or cell phones and select a TRC (telephone reliability code) of either high (recommended), medium, or low.
